Big Brady picks Dustin Poirier to win, citing his superior boxing, pressure in the smaller cage, and ability to cut off angles. He notes that Hooker absorbs a lot of strikes (5.13 per minute) and has taken damage in recent fights, which could lead to a late finish. He also mentions that Hooker's competition has been a step below Poirier's, and that Poirier's durability and cardio should carry him through. He predicts a fourth-round knockout.
Daniel Levi picks Dustin Poirier to win, citing Poirier's superior boxing, cardio, and output, especially in later rounds. He notes that Poirier's defense has improved and he no longer makes lunging mistakes. Levi believes Poirier's mindset is focused and he will not let Hooker off the hook, predicting a finish in the second or third round. He acknowledges Hooker's durability and sneaky tools like high knees but thinks Poirier's firepower and experience will prevail.
The MMA Guru picks Dan Hooker to beat Dustin Poirier, arguing that Hooker's reach advantage and calf kicks will be key. He believes Hooker will land multiple calf kicks early, affecting Poirier's movement, and that Poirier loads up too much when hurt, leaving his chin exposed. He predicts a TKO finish via knee up the middle in the late first or early second round, citing Hooker's activity and Poirier's potential lack of hunger after the Khabib loss.
